Output 18d78187cfdf1f7a1dde2e4be40cde50c1542fa53583100ba85bc8d438592356:1

value
28837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 865d3e650be7d1d14fa993177ea8bb4e064a5002 OP_EQUAL
address
3DwUAwJ4oAAmA4eEeWME9yCLLZPTY4L3PX
transaction
18d78187cfdf1f7a1dde2e4be40cde50c1542fa53583100ba85bc8d438592356
spent
true